What makes Hinge different — and why it works in Indian metros

Hinge replaces the double-blind swipe with a prompt-and-comment system. Instead of swiping on photos, you respond to specific things on someone's profile — a prompt they wrote, a photo they posted, or a question they answered. This one design change creates a fundamentally different experience.

The result in India: people who fill out Hinge profiles are self-selected as serious. You don't spend 5 minutes filling in prompts if you're just casually browsing. The ghost rate on Hinge India is approximately 25% — compared to Tinder's ~60%. That difference is the prompt system working exactly as intended.

Is Hinge+ worth $29.99/month in India?

Hinge's premium tier is expensive by Indian standards. Here's our honest breakdown of what you get:

PlanPriceLikes per daySee who liked youFilters
FreeStart here₹08/dayBasic
Hinge+$29.99/moUnlimitedAdvanced
HingeX$49.99/moUnlimitedPriority + Roses

Our verdict: Start with the free tier. 8 likes per day is genuinely enough in most Indian cities. Only upgrade to Hinge+ if you're consistently hitting the daily limit AND you're in a city with a large enough pool to justify unlimited likes (Mumbai, Bangalore, Delhi). HingeX is not worth it for most Indian users.

5 tips to get better results on Hinge in India

Tip 01
Write prompts with local context
Generic prompts get generic responses. "A perfect Sunday in Koramangala: Toit for lunch, cycling 100 Feet Road, dinner at Fatty Bao" gets more engagement than "I like brunch and outdoor activities." Specificity is Hinge's superpower — use it.
Tip 02
Comment on something specific, not just the photo
When you like someone's profile, comment on their prompt or photo with something specific. "What was it like hiking Hampi solo?" beats a heart on their travel photo every time. Specific comments get 4x more responses than emoji reactions.
Tip 03
Use the "Hot Takes" or opinion prompts
Prompts that share a genuine opinion consistently generate the most conversations on Hinge India. "Butter chicken is overrated" or "Mumbai rain is actually the best time to be here" polarises intentionally — and polarising gets conversations started.
Tip 04
Expand radius strategically
In cities outside the top 4 metros, expand your Hinge radius to 60–80km. Many Hinge users in smaller cities have set narrow radii that exclude each other. Widening yours captures these profiles.
Tip 05
Respond within 24 hours
Match enthusiasm on Hinge drops sharply after 48 hours of silence. Hinge shows you the comment they left on your profile — respond directly to it. The most natural response to "What was it like hiking solo?" is just answering the question.

FAQ — Hinge India

Is Hinge available in India? +
Yes. Hinge is available across India on iOS and Android. It works best in Mumbai, Bangalore, Delhi, Pune, and Hyderabad. Outside major metros, the user base is thin — Tinder is a better option in Tier 2 cities.
Is Hinge free in India? +
Yes. Hinge has a free tier with 8 likes per day. This is enough to start getting matches without paying. Hinge+ costs $29.99/month for unlimited likes. We recommend starting free and only upgrading if you hit the daily limit consistently.
Hinge vs Tinder in India — which is better? +
Depends on your city and goal. In metros (Mumbai, Bangalore, Delhi): Hinge wins for quality and serious relationships. In Tier 2 cities: Tinder wins for volume — Hinge has too few users. For casual dating anywhere: Tinder. For serious relationships in metros: Hinge. Most active metro daters use both.
Does Hinge work in smaller Indian cities? +
Poorly. Hinge's user base in India is concentrated in the top 6–8 metro cities. In cities like Jaipur, Lucknow, Indore, or Nagpur, the pool is very thin. Set your radius to 80km+ to maximise options, but for most Tier 2 users, Tinder is the primary app.
